Talent.com
This job offer is not available in your country.
Datavail Infotech - Senior Associate Database Administrator

Datavail Infotech - Senior Associate Database Administrator

DatavailHyderabad
30+ days ago
Job description

About the Role :

We are seeking an experienced Senior Associate Database Administrator with deep expertise in PostgreSQL (Open Source & EDB) and hands-on experience across multi-cloud environments (AWS, Azure, GCP). The ideal candidate will have a proven track record of managing mission-critical databases, architecting high-availability solutions, executing performance tuning, and delivering robust backup and recovery strategies. You will be part of Datavails Global PostgreSQL Practice, working with diverse clients, complex architectures, and cutting-edge cloud technologies.

Key Responsibilities Administration & Architecture :

  • Administer, configure, and maintain PostgreSQL databases (Open Source and EDB PostgreSQL) across on-premises and cloud (AWS RDS & Aurora, Microsoft Azure Database for PostgreSQL, GCP).
  • Perform database installation using source code, RPM packages, and one-click deployment methods.
  • Architect and implement high availability and disaster recovery strategies, including replication (streaming, cascading), failover, and DR servers.
  • Configure and manage load balancing using pgpool.

Backup, Recovery & Upgrades :

  • Design and execute logical and physical backup strategies using BARMAN, pgbackrest, and native PostgreSQL tools.
  • Implement and test Point-in-Time Recovery (PITR) and restore strategies (pg_restore, pg_dump, pg_upgrade).
  • Manage version upgrades (major & minor) with zero or minimal downtime.
  • Apply database patches and security updates in a controlled, documented manner.
  • Performance Monitoring & Tuning :

  • Monitor database health using pgAdmin, pgbadger, pgbouncer, and custom scripts.
  • Optimize database parameters for maximum performance and stability.
  • Investigate and resolve performance bottlenecks, query tuning, and resource utilization issues.
  • Configure query analytics in Azure Query Store and set up performance dashboards.
  • Cloud & Cross-Platform Integration :

  • Provision and manage AWS Aurora PostgreSQL clusters, configure read replicas, and tune parameter groups.
  • Integrate PostgreSQL logs with AWS S3 and Azure Log Analytics for centralized monitoring.
  • Configure heterogeneous database connections between Oracle and PostgreSQL.
  • Execute and lead Oracle-to-PostgreSQL migrations using migration tools and custom scripts.
  • Automation & Scripting :

  • Develop shell scripts for automated backups, maintenance tasks, and monitoring alerts.
  • Automate routine DBA operations to improve efficiency and reliability.
  • Implement proactive monitoring and self-healing scripts for database & Security :
  • Diagnose and resolve database corruption issues and unexpected failures.
  • Implement and enforce security best practices, including user access control, tablespace management, and encryption.
  • Maintain compliance with organizational and industry security standards.
  • Required Skills & Tools :

  • PostgreSQL Core & EDB PostgreSQL Architecture, replication, backup & recovery.
  • Monitoring & Administration Tools pgAdmin, pgbadger, pgbouncer, pg_repack, repmgr.
  • Backup & DR Tools BARMAN, pgbackrest.
  • Cloud Platforms AWS (RDS, Aurora), Azure (PostgreSQL, Query Store), GCP (PostgreSQL).
  • Performance & Tuning Query optimization, parameter tuning, connection pooling.
  • Scripting Strong in Linux shell scripting for automation.
  • Migration Expertise Oracle-to-PostgreSQL migration strategies and execution.
  • (ref : hirist.tech)

    Create a job alert for this search

    Database Administrator • Hyderabad